The Dandong–Xilinhot Expressway (Chinese: 丹东—锡林浩特高速公路), commonly referred to as the Danxi Expressway (Chinese: 丹锡高速公路) is an expressway that connects the cities of Dandong, Liaoning, China, and Xilinhot, Inner Mongolia. When fully complete, it will be 960 km (600 mi) in length.
Currently, the expressway is complete between Dandong and Baarin Right Banner.
